Dakota Wealth Management Reduces Stock Holdings in First Interstate BancSystem, Inc. (NASDAQ:FIBK)

First Interstate BancSystem logo with Finance background

Dakota Wealth Management lessened its position in shares of First Interstate BancSystem, Inc. (NASDAQ:FIBK - Free Report) by 54.0%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 9,213 shares of the financial services provider's stock after selling 10,794 shares during the quarter. Dakota Wealth Management's holdings in First Interstate BancSystem were worth $264,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Several other large investors have also added to or reduced their stakes in FIBK. Wood Tarver Financial Group LLC purchased a new position in First Interstate BancSystem in the fourth quarter worth approximately $26,000. JNBA Financial Advisors acquired a new stake in shares of First Interstate BancSystem in the first quarter valued at $29,000. Meeder Asset Management Inc. acquired a new stake in First Interstate BancSystem in the fourth quarter valued at $69,000. Covestor Ltd raised its stake in First Interstate BancSystem by 25.8% in the fourth quarter. Covestor Ltd now owns 2,485 shares of the financial services provider's stock valued at $81,000 after buying an additional 510 shares in the last quarter. Finally, Sterling Capital Management LLC increased its position in shares of First Interstate BancSystem by 826.3% during the fourth quarter. Sterling Capital Management LLC now owns 2,501 shares of the financial services provider's stock worth $81,000 after purchasing an additional 2,231 shares in the last quarter. Hedge funds and other institutional investors own 88.71% of the company's stock.

Insider Activity

In other news, major shareholder Susan Scott Heyneman Trust, Su sold 55,000 shares of the business's st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, July 14th. The shares were sold at an average price of $31.11, for a total transaction of $1,711,050.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ider directly owned 584,256 shares of the company's stock, valued at $18,176,204.16. The trade was a 8.60%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website. Insiders own 8.20% of the company's stock.

Wall Street Analysts Forecast Growth

FIBK has been the topic of a number of research reports. Wells Fargo & Company raised their price target on First Interstate BancSystem from $25.00 to $28.00 and gave the stock an "underweight" rating in a report on Thursday, July 10th.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ods upgraded First Interstate BancSystem from a "hold" rating to a "moderate buy" rating and set a $32.00 price target for the company in a report on Monday, June 23rd. Barclays raised shares of First Interstate BancSystem from an "underweight" rating to an "equal weight" rating and boosted their price objective for the company from $28.00 to $32.00 in a research note on Tuesday, July 8th. Finally, Wall Street Zen raised shares of First Interstate BancSystem from a "sell" rating to a "hold" rating in a research report on Saturday, May 10th.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, three have given a hold rating and three have assigned a bu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, the company presently has a consensus rating of "Hold" and an average target price of $35.43.

First Interstate BancSystem Stock Performance

NASDAQ FIBK opened at $30.77 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.37, a current ratio of 0.77 and a quick ratio of 0.77. The firm has a market capitalization of $3.23 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 14.58 and a beta of 0.79. First Interstate BancSystem, Inc. has a 52-week low of $22.95 and a 52-week high of $36.77. The company's fifty day moving average is $28.16 and its two-hundred day moving average is $29.13.

First Interstate BancSystem (NASDAQ:FIBK -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 29th. The financial services provider reported $0.49 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.56 by ($0.07). First Interstate BancSystem had a return on equity of 6.57% and a net margin of 14.93%. The business had revenue of $42.00 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$253.50 million.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$0.57 EPS. First Interstate BancSystem's revenue for the quarter was up 2.0%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ities research analysts forecast that First Interstate BancSystem, Inc. will post 2.53 EPS for the current year.

First Interstate BancSystem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, May 22nd. Shareholders of record on Monday, May 12th were paid a $0.47 dividend. This represents a $1.88 annualized dividend and a yield of 6.11%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 12th. First Interstate BancSystem's dividend payout ratio is presently 89.10%.

About First Interstate BancSystem

(Free Report)

First Interstate BancSystem, Inc operates as the bank holding company for First Interstate Bank that provides range of banking products and services in the United States. It offers various traditional depository products, including checking, savings, and time deposits; and repurchase agreements primarily for commercial and municipal depositors.
